Background Information

"Ultimately a genuine leader is not a searcher for consensus but a molder of consensus" (King, 1967, para. 19). In this first module, you will critically analyze the meaning of leadership. How is leadership defined? Is there universal agreement about what leadership is? How do you personally define leadership? In our textbook, The Art of Leadership, Manning and Curtis (2014) provide several frameworks for thinking about leadership: as a trait, as an ability, as a skill, as a behavior, as a relationship, and as an influence on process. Consider whether any of these frameworks resonate with your views. Throughout this course, remain open to examining, understanding, and even refining your own views.

Discussion Prompt

It is time to elect a world leader, and your vote counts. Below you will find information on three leading candidates. Which of these candidates is your choice?

Candidate A:

Associates with ward heelers and consults with astrologists. He has had two

mistresses, Chain-smokes, and drinks 8 to 10 martinis a day.

Candidate B:

Was kicked out of office twice.

Sleeps until noon.

Used opium in college.

Drinks a quart of brandy every evening.

Candidate C:

Is a decorated war hero.

Is a vegetarian.

Doesn''t smoke.

Drinks an occasional beer.

Hasn''t had any illicit affairs.

Answers: A: Franklin Roosevelt B: Winston Churchill C: Adolf Hitler

As you read those qualities for the above leaders, what were your initial thoughts? Did you associate certain characteristics listed above with leadership? Leadership is both a research area and a practical skill encompassing the ability of an individual or organization to "lead" or guide other individuals, teams, or entire organizations. Specialist literature debates various viewpoints, contrasting Eastern and Western approaches to leadership, and also (within the West) United States versus European approaches. U.S. academic environments define leadership as "a process of social influence in which a person can enlist the aid and support of others in the accomplishment of a common task".
